Long-Term vs Roll off dumpsters

Whether or not you need a long-term or roll off dumpster depends upon the kind of job and service you need. Long-Term dumpster service is for continuing demands that last more than just a couple of days. This includes matters like day-to-day waste and recycling needs. Temporary service is exactly what the name suggests; a one-time need for job-special waste removal.

Temporary roll off dumpsters are delivered on a truck and are rolled off where they will be utilized. These are generally larger containers that can manage all the waste that comes with that particular job. Long-Term dumpsters are usually smaller containers as they are emptied on a regular basis and so don't need to hold as much at one time.

If you request a long-term dumpster, some companies require at least a one-year service agreement for that dumpster. Roll off dumpsters merely require a rental fee for the time that you keep the dumpster on the job.


Do I need a permit to rent a dumpster in Little Sioux?

If that is your first time renting a dumpster in Little Sioux, you may not know what is legally permissible in regards to the placement of the dumpster. If you intend to place the dumpster totally on your own property, you're not ordinarily required to obtain a permit.

If, nevertheless, your project needs you to place the dumpster on a public road or roadway, this may normally mean you have to submit an application for a permit. It's always wise to check with your local city or county offices (maybe the parking enforcement department) in case you own a question regarding the requirement for a permit on a road.

If you fail to get a permit and discover out afterwards that you were required to have one, you may likely face a fine from your local authorities. In most dumpster rental in Little Sioux cases, though, you should be just fine without a permit as long as you keep the dumpster on your property.

10 yard dumpster dimensions in Little Sioux

A 10 yard dumpster is built to hold 10 cubic yards of waste and debris. A 10 yard dumpster will measure about 12 feet long by 8 feet wide by four feet high, although exact container sizes will change with different companies.

It may be difficult to select just the container size you will need for your home job, but a 10 yard dumpster works well for smaller cleaning jobs. To give you an idea, a 10 yard dumpster would hold:

  • Debris cleanout from a basement or garage A 250 square foot deck that has been removed
  • A single layer of 1,500 square feet of roof shingles
  • The debris from a little kitchen or bathroom remodeling job

If your job is large enough that you do not have room in your truck to haul everything to the dump, but little enough that you do not desire an enormous container, a 10 yard dumpster should work perfectly.


How high can I fill my dumpster?

You can fill your dumpster as high as you like, as long as you really do not load it higher compared to the sides of the container. Overfilling the dumpster could cause the waste or debris to slide off as the dumpster is loaded onto the truck or as the truck is driving. Overloaded or big-boned dumpsters are simply not safe, and businesses will not take unsafe loads in order to safeguard motorists and passengers on the road.

In some places, dumpster loads must be tarped for safety. If your load is too high, it will not be able to be tarped so you would have to remove a number of the debris before it can be hauled away. This might lead to extra fees if it needs you to keep the dumpster for a longer duration of time. Don't forget to maintain your load no higher compared to the sides of the dumpster, and you'll be fine.

Some Things That You Can Not Put into Your Dumpster

Although the particular rules that control what you can and cannot comprise in a dumpster change from area to area, there are several types of substances that most dumpster rental service in Little Siouxs WOn't permit. A number of the things which you typically cannot place in the dumpster comprise:

Batteries, notably the kind that contain mercury Automotive fluids like used motor oil, engine coolants, and transmission fluid Pesticides and herbicides that could pollute groundwater Paints and solvents (they include oils and other chemicals that can harm the environment) Electronics, especially those that include batteries There are additionally some mattresses you could generally place in your dumpster as long as you are willing to pay an added fee. These include: Appliances Mattresses Tires

When in doubt, it's best to get in touch with your rental business to get a list of stuff that you just can not place into the dumpster.

What Size Dumpster Do I Want for a Roofing Project?

Picking a dumpster size requires some educated guesswork. It is often difficult for individuals to gauge the sizes that they need for roofing projects because, practically, they have no idea how much material their roofs contain.

There are, nevertheless, some basic guidelines you'll be able to follow to make a good choice. In the event you are removing a commercial roof, then you will most likely need a dumpster that offers you at least 40 square yards.

In the event you are working on residential roofing project, then you can ordinarily rely on a smaller size. You can generally expect a 1,500 square foot roof to fill a 10-yard dumpster. Single shingle roof debris from a 2,500-3,000 square foot roof will likely desire a 20-yard dumpster.

A lot of folks order one size larger than they believe their endeavors will take since they wish to stay away from the extra expense and hassle of replacing complete dumpsters that weren't large enough.

What is the Dissimilarity Between a Roll Off and Front Load Dumpster?

Roll off and front load dumpsters have attributes which make them useful for different types of occupations.

A roll off dumpster is delivered to your project place and left there until you need a truck to haul it and your debris away. They often have open tops and also a door on the front. That makes it easy for workers to load a wide selection of debris into the dumpster.

A front load dumpster has mechanical arms that that lift containers off the ground. The arms lean to pour the debris into the truck's dumpster. This is a useful alternative for businesses that amass large amounts of garbage.

While roll off dumpsters are typically left on place, front load dumpsters will come pick up debris on a set program. That makes it feasible for sanitation professionals to remove garbage and trash for multiple residences and businesses in the area at affordable costs.
